How do Lexington's local soil and drainage conditions influence material choice and installation?

Local soils in parts of the West Nebraska area can be fine-grained and hold water, so you may need more free-draining aggregates and a compacted base to prevent rutting or poor drainage. Proper grading, foundation layers, and sometimes geotextile fabric reduce mixing between native soil and new material and improve longevity. What are common quantities ordered for driveways, patios, and landscaping projects in Lexington?

Common homeowner orders vary by project: small walkways and patch jobs are often 1–3 tons, single-car driveways are typically 15–25 tons, two-car driveways 25–50 tons, and larger driveway rebuilds or contractor jobs can exceed 100 tons. A quick rule: calculate area in square feet, choose target depth, then use our online calculator—1 cubic yard covers roughly 100 sq ft at a 3-inch depth and 1 cubic yard generally weighs between about 1.2–1.7 tons depending on the material group.

Can you spread the material after it is dumped?

We cannot get out of the truck and manually spread it. However, depending on the location, safety, and comfortability of the driver – we may be able to tailgate spread your material. This involves pulling the truck forward as material is being dumped to make it easier for you to distribute material after delivery.
